A030162 Cubes such that in n and n^(1/3) the parity of digits alternates. 3
0, 1, 8, 27, 125, 216, 343, 729, 5832, 12167, 614125, 658503, 1030301, 1092727, 27270901, 27818127, 47832147, 381078125 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
